The Evolution of Robot Vacuums
The very first robot vacuum was presented in the late 1990s, however it wasn't until the early 2000s that they ended up being commercially popular. For many years, advancements in technology, consisting of enhanced sensors, smarter navigation systems, and boosted suction power, have actually considerably increased their efficiency.
Secret Features of Robot Vacuums
Robot vacuums have a myriad of functions that set them apart from conventional vacuum cleaners. Below are some key qualities:
Feature
Description
Smart Navigation
A lot of robot vacuums use a mix of sensors and cameras to draw up the home, recognizing barriers and producing an optimum cleaning course.
Scheduled Cleaning
Users can set cleaning schedules, allowing the vacuum to operate immediately at designated times, even when house owners are away.
Self-Charging
Numerous models can return to their charging docks autonomously when their battery runs low, guaranteeing they are always prepared for the next cleaning session.
App Connectivity
Lots of robot vacuums now provide mobile phone apps allowing users to manage and keep an eye on cleaning sessions remotely.
Several Surface Capability
Robot vacuums can generally shift seamlessly in between different floor types, including carpets, hardwood, and tiles, changing their cleaning mode accordingly.
Benefits of Using Robot Vacuums
The uptake of robot vacuums in homes can be credited to different benefits:
- Time-Saving: Robot vacuums operate autonomously, permitting house owners to concentrate on other tasks or delight in leisure time.
- Consistency: These devices can perform more frequent cleaning sessions compared to conventional vacuums, assisting keep a regularly neat environment.
- Compact Design: With their slim profiles, robot vacuums can easily steer under furniture and into tight areas, a benefit over bulkier vacuum models.
- Integrative Technology: Many robot vacuums work with smart home systems, enabling voice-activated commands through gadgets like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
- Decreased Allergens: Frequent vacuuming with a robot helps capture dust and irritants, contributing to better air quality, which is especially useful for allergy sufferers.
Factors to consider Before Purchasing a Robot Vacuum
Before purchasing a robot vacuum, it is necessary to consider numerous aspects:
- Home Layout: Homes with open floor plans may benefit more from robot vacuums, while those with many rooms and doorsteps might present difficulties.
- Pet Hair: If you have family pets, picking a model designed for managing pet hair and dander is crucial.
- Battery Life: Some models can clean for longer durations than others, making it necessary to choose based upon the size of your home.
- Price Range: Robot vacuums are available in a variety of prices. It's vital to discover a model that fits your budget while satisfying your cleaning requirements.
- Maintenance Needs: Regular maintenance is key to prolonging the life of your robot vacuum. Users must clean filters, brushes, and sensors periodically.
Popular Robot Vacuums
Here are a few of the leading robot vacuum models on the market today, which deal with different requirements and preferences:
- iRobot Roomba Series: Known for its dependability and brand name acknowledgment, the Roomba series includes designs ideal for different price points and features.
- Roborock S7: This design excels with its mopping capability, making it a versatile option for different types of floorings.
- Ecovacs Deebot: Offering features like mop and vacuum abilities, the Deebot variety is an economical choice for budget-conscious customers.
- Neato Botvac: This model is understood for its unique D-shape style, which provides better corner cleaning abilities.
